fantast

noun
fan·​tast | \ ˈfan-ˌtast How to pronounce fantast (audio) \

Definition of fantast

1 : visionary
2 : a fantastic or eccentric person
3 : fantasist

First Known Use of fantast

1588, in the meaning defined at sense 1

History and Etymology for fantast

German, from Medieval Latin fantasta, probably back-formation from Late Latin phantasticus
